He lost his marriage, his health, his home — but what he found in recovery was life itself.
In this episode of The Cup of Joe Show, we sit down with Chris B., who found freedom in recovery on July 25, 2023, and whose story reminds us that it’s never too late to start over.
Chris grew up in Georgia as the youngest of four, chasing success while quietly battling a growing dependence on alcohol. A University of Georgia grad and international security expert, Chris spent decades traveling the world under immense pressure. After the 9/11 attacks, his work intensified and so did his drinking.
What began as social drinking turned into blackout binges, health crises, and devastating losses: his marriage, his job, and nearly his life. When his mother staged an intervention, Chris finally chose life over destruction.
In treatment, he discovered the power of recovery and the global fellowship of AA from Vienna to East Tennessee. In his words, “God brought me to AA, and AA brought me to God.”
Today, he lives a life grounded in faith, gratitude, and service. He’s converted to Catholicism, volunteers weekly for the AA Hotline, and says his peace comes from “focusing on the next step, not the staircase.”
Chris’s journey is one of redemption, humility, and the unshakable belief that no matter how far we fall, recovery is always possible.
